EGYPT, Alexandria. Philip II. As Caesar, AD 244-247. BI Tetradrachm (24mm, 13.77 g, 12h). Dated RY 4 of Philip I (AD 246/7). Bareheaded and cuirassed bust right, seen from the front, gorgoneion on breastplate / Hermanubis standing facing, head right, wearing kalathos, holding palm frond and caduceus; at his feet to left, jackal standing left, head right; L ∆ (date) across field. Köln 2790; Dattari (Savio) 5029; K&G 76.32; RPC VIII Online 2522; Emmett 3592.4. Dark brown patina, slight porosity. Good VF.

From Dr. R. Craig Kammerer Collection.
